

Climate Change and the Nation State
Book • 2021
In 'Climate Change and the Nation State', Anatol Lieven presents a realist perspective on addressing climate change by leveraging nationalism and the power of nation-states.
He argues that framing climate change as a threat to national security can galvanize public support and action.
Lieven advocates for a civic nationalism that transcends ethnic divisions to tackle this global challenge effectively.
